Solution for 3m(2)-5m=12 equation:



3m(2)-5m=12
We move all terms to the left:
3m(2)-5m-(12)=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
3m^2-5m-12=0
a = 3; b = -5; c = -12;
Δ = b2-4ac
Δ = -52-4·3·(-12)
Δ = 169
The delta value is higher than zero, so the equation has two solutions
We use following formulas to calculate our solutions:
$m_{1}=\frac{-b-\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}$
$m_{2}=\frac{-b+\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}$

$\sqrt{\Delta}=\sqrt{169}=13$
$m_{1}=\frac{-b-\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}=\frac{-(-5)-13}{2*3}=\frac{-8}{6} =-1+1/3 $
$m_{2}=\frac{-b+\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}=\frac{-(-5)+13}{2*3}=\frac{18}{6} =3 $
